1. A device for controlling fluid flow, the device comprising:

  • one or more transducers, each transducer comprising at least two electrodes and an electroactive polymer in electrical communication with the at least two electrodes wherein a portion of the electroactive polymer is arranged to deflect from a first position to a second position in response to a change in electric field;

    at least one surface in contact with a fluid and operatively coupled to the one or more transducers wherein the deflection of the portion of the electroactive polymer causes a change in a characteristic of the fluid that is transmitted to the fluid via the one surface,wherein the electroactive polymer has an elastic modulus below about 100 MPa.
